A.P. Moller-Maersk (Maersk) has opened a new logistics facility at the Port of Barcelona.

The newly built 8,168m2 facility will provide logistics services to the Iberian Peninsula and the South of France.

The facility has with an 11-metre-high storage area and 39 loading docks which makes it flagship for transfer operations in Barcelona.

The building includes self-sufficient energy generating solar panels and electric vehicle chargers.

The centre’s main focus is the deconsolidation of imported goods for their subsequent distribution both in Spain and Portugal as well as the South of France, commented Diego Perdones, Managing Director for Southwest Europe and Maghreb at Maersk.

The new warehouse, certified under LEED standard with Gold category, has been built by Centro Intermodal de Logística, S.A. (CILSA) under the turnkey modality on plot A30 of the ZAL Port (Prat) – of which 14,409m2 lies within the Port of Barcelona.

“This facility is equipped with the most modern technology for logistics activity, a key aspect in the global supply chain that is increasingly focused on the flow and visibility of information behind the movement of goods,” Perdones added.

Maersk’s new facility for Southern West Europe is part of CILSA`s new building projects within the ZAL Port (adding 350,000m2), an industrial area of adding 920,000m2 that will be part of a Logistics Park specifically designed for storage, management distribution and transportation of cargo.
